Statistics without Borders Receives Humanity Road’s Da Vinci Award

1 June 2015 348 views No Comment

Statistics without Borders (SWB) is a recipient of Humanity Road’s 2014 Da Vinci Award, which is presented to a patron or contributor that supports its programs. SWB was honored for coauthoring and publishing Guide to Social Media Emergency Management Analytics, a tool for emergency managers and decision-makers that helps them identify and discuss relevant questions when planning social media in emergency management response. “We wish to thank SWB for all their help in performing the data study and contributing to this important guidebook,” said Humanity Road President Chris Thompson.

Humanity Road delivers disaster preparedness and response information to the global mobile public before, during, and after a disaster.

A version of Guide to Social Media Emergency Management Analytics will be published in the June issue of Statistical Journal of IAOS.
